On September 29, 2009 producer and composer Eric Serra announced the launch of a new European TV music project, the EuroVoice European Music Contest, at a press conference in Paris.
This progressive idea, paired with sophisticated new technology, has enabled EuroVoice to start a musical revolution and really sets this music contest apart from all others. EuroVoice is the first music contest which does not use a selective panel of judges to decide the winner. Instead, it is the listening and viewing public who decide. EuroVoice wants to bring honesty, openness, transparency and political
impartiality back to the European music industry.
Nino Bakradze, member of the EuroVoice Organising Committee:
“We want to give talented musicians a chance to break into the music industry. We hope to discover at least 20 new acts…”
Musicians, singers and bands from any country in Europe, Turkey and Israel can take part in the EuroVoice Music Contest. The Contest is supported by famous music stars from all around the world.
Eric Serra, producer, amazing bass-guitarist and composer of the film soundtracks to The Fifth Element, Nikita, Leon and Joan of Arc, is the EuroVoice Music Contest President and Chairman of the Council of Experts.
Eric Serra, EuroVoice European Music Contest President and Chairman of the Council of Experts:
“The main thing which sets the EuroVoice Contest apart from all the others is that all the public votes will be clearly displayed online on the Contest Portal. You will be able to see the number of people who have voted and check the results. I cannot influence the voting process in any way whatsoever. Only the results of the public vote will decide the winner. All I can do is observe the proceedings…”
